21st Kohima Royal Gold Cup: Aizawl FC become champions

Mizoram-side Aizawl FC are the champions of the 21st Kohima Royal Gold Cup! The team from the neighbouring state won 3-1 in the final against late replacements Barak FC yesterday.

The 21st edition of Kohima Royal Gold Cup was played from November 16 to 29 at the Local Ground, Kohima. The Royal Gold Cup, organized by the Royal Club in Kohima, is the only football tournament in the state of Nagaland to be affiliated to the All India Football Federation (AIFF) and conducted under the aegis of the Nagaland Football Association (NFA).

The winning team Aizawl FC took home a cash prize of Rs 150,000 (1.5 lakhs), while the runners-up Barak FC received Rs 100,000 (1 lakh) with both finalists getting trophies and citations.

RESULTS

Pre-Quarterfinals16-Nov-2012: Kohima Komets 6-1 HQ IGAR17-Nov-2012: Head Hunter 1-2 Nagaland Police19-Nov-2012: Barak FC 1-1,4-3 Twenty XI [penalties]20-Nov-2012: Lamkang FC 0-3 Life Sports FC

Quarterfinals21-Nov-2012: Imphal East FA 0-1 Kohima Komets22-Nov-2012: Nagaland Police – TRAU, Manipur (walkover N.P. as TRAU failed to turn-up)23-Nov-2012: ARC, Shillong 1-1,2-4 Barak FC24-Nov-2012: Aizawl FC 2-0 Life Sports FC

Semifinal26-Nov-2012: Kohima Komets 1-3 Barak FC27-Nov-2012: Nagaland Police 2-3 Aizawl FC

Final29-Nov-2012: Barak FC 1-3 Aizawl FC
